====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E DINESH KUMAR SINGH ORAL ORDER 02/ 12-07-2016 Heard learned counsels for the petitioners and the State.
The petitioners being the parents, brothers and married sister of the husband of the informant are apprehending their arrest in a case registered for the offences punishable under Sections 498A, 341, 342, 323, 504/34 of the Indian Penal Code and 3/4 of Dowry Prohibition Act. The basic accusation is of torture after four years of the marriage for non-fulfillment of the dowry demand,
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.28400 of 2016 (2) dt.12-07-2016 2/3 making assault to the informant and in-laws of the informant driven out the informant from the matrimonial house. It is submitted by learned counsel for the petitioners that the petitioners admit the marriage of the informant with the son of petitioner no. 1, namely, Suchit Kumar and birth of two children. Subsequently the relationship got strained and husband of the informant filed Matrimonial Suit No. 188 of 2015 with a prayer for divorce. It is further submitted that an application was filed by the informant before the police that the issue has been reconciled between the parties. The said application was filed on 13.03.2016 which has been brought on record as Annexure-3 and thereafter for the alleged occurrence of 13.03.2016 the present FIR was registered on 14.03.
2016, though, subsequently the accused side have also lodged Nawada Town P.S. Case No. 196 of 2016 on 19.03.2016. It is further submitted that the thrust of accusation is against the husband of the informant and the petitioners undertake that they have no objection in allowing the informant to enjoy her share of property in the matrimonial house.
It is submitted by learned counsel for the informant that the accused persons also inflicted torture and they instigated the husband of the informant.

No.28400 of 2016 (2) dt.12-07-2016 3/3 Considering the thrust of accusation against the husband of the informant, let the above named petitioners be released on anticipatory bail, in the event of arrest or surrender before the learned court below within a period of twelve weeks from today, on furnishing bail bonds of Rs.10,000/- (Ten thousand) each with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of learned Additional Chief Judicial Magistrate-III, Nawada in connection with Nawada Mahila P.S. Case No. 14 of 2016, subject to the conditions as laid down under Section 438(2) of the Cr.P.C.
The bail bonds of the petitioners shall be accepted by the learned court below on filing separate affidavit that they will allow the informant to enjoy her share of property in the matrimonial house. The learned court below will get the said affidavit transmitted to the concerned police station. (Dinesh Kumar Singh, J) DKS/- U T
